Replacing windows involves several variables that change the final bill. The size and style of the window are big factors; fixed glass usually costs less than units that open, like double-hung or casement styles. Your choice of frame material—vinyl, wood, or fiberglass—also shifts the number significantly, as does the glass package you choose for energy efficiency.
